    Not surprising that memories are somewhat hazy that far back. Having been there many times I just do not recall Apollo ever being a dance bar! As I remember it was a small space with a small bar on the left as you entered and a sort of zig zag catwalk on which the boys did their stuff. The rest of the space was seating for customers. I wonder if you might be thinking of Rome Club which then was the famous Soi 4 gay dance club.
